I monitor through a mixer, never through ableton so I turn on driver error compensation and I always turn every audio track from Auto to off before I record so that the driver error compensation can work. It's all fine in 32 bit, but in 64 bit my audio recordings don't match up with the midi I'm send out of Ableton. They're late in a quantized way. I experienced this in Ableton in 32 bit mode before I turned Auto off, but now no matter what it happens in Ableton 64 bit.

Very difficult to keep track of and work around. Please help if you can.
